Hi guys there are some great cars on here so i thought id add mine to balance it out :lol:

Exterior:

Summer wheels: VW Starlites with genuine vw nut covers

Winter wheels: Borbet 13s

Lowered on FK streetsport coilovers

FK Highsport shorter rear springs

Custom painted front badge red inner black outer

Sport fog lights and lower valance

Custom painted rear badge

Deleted rub strips

Polo 9n3 Aero rear wiper conversion

Lupo GTI front aero wiper conversion

Genuine VW rear mud flaps

Genuine and rare votex accessory front grill

Pressed German style UK legal number plates with GB edge

Black tinted headlights and indicators

Tinted side repeaters

Interior:

Pop-Out rear windows with trimmed gti pillar trims

GTI lower door cards

Audi TT Black leather front seats and matching rears

Polo 6n2 glove box and lower dash conversion

Polo 6n2 centre console

Polo 6n2 GTI handbrake cover

Black leather gear gator with red stitching

Gloss black vents and surrounds

Later style stereo surround with hazard switch

Lupo GTI Black rear view mirror

Intermittent programmable wiper relay

Comfort indicators retrofit VW kit

Passat W8 dome light with ambient LED's and individual map lights frosted lens

Polo GTI seatbelts with red edging strip in front standard in back

Lupo GTI clock surround modified for Lupo 1.4 clocks with custom cover

Chrome headlight switch with front fogs

Custom trimmed parcel shelf

Lupo gti black headliner and grabhandles

16v badge on front

In Car Entertainment:

VW MFD sat nav head unit with colour screen

2010 maps disk

CD changer in boot

PS2 in boot

Upgraded speakers to alpine components

Parrot hands-free kit with Bluetooth streaming

Kroad Speed camera detection unit

Engine:

Standard AWH engine

NGK plugs

BMC CDA Carbon cold air feed

Painted manifold cover

Polo 6n2GTI modified engine cover

I'm liking the PS2 in the boot, was the Radio factory fitted or added?

  • Author

Cheers buddy no not for sale yet.

The radio was retrofitted by me its a VW MFD-D which can also be fitted in a 6n2 they were fitted to high end boras around 2002.

Its actually a pretty good sat nav as it uses the car speed sensor aswell as GPS so if you go into a tunnel it still works.

love the car mate , how easy was it to fit those seats ?

  • Author

Cheers buddy

The fronts were relatively easy to do. I used the front floor mount to go onto a bar i welded to the Audi runners then welded a thin bar at the back and bolted it to the top of the runners. Its uses the original mounts and the cars nice and thick so its all safe.

The rears were a bit harder the base just about sits in place so that's easy. The backs were stripped of their seat-belts, had the Audi mounts cut off and i then used some threaded bar to attach the lupo mounts to them. And to get them to clip in i shaped some metal adapters and then attached the lupo clips at the top.

Also got these from a breakers yard my mate works at for a steal:

IMG_1121.jpg

Lupo gti inlet manifold and polo 16v afh cable throttle. My intention is to put these on the awh engine in the car and see what gains i get now i have more airflow. Also being an early lupo i have sport injectors already. I'm not bothered about BHP really i just want to see if it makes it a bit more pokey to drive.
